
The Kane Forest Preserve Foundation actively works to restore, restock, protect and preserve forest preserve lands for the education, recreation and pleasure of all who live here — people, plants and wildlife.

Less than one-tenth of one percent of the original Illinois prairie remains. The Foundation is a charitable organization that helps the Forest Preserve District of Kane County's efforts to acquire, restore and protect prairies, woodlands and s, wetlands throughout Kane County.
The Kane Forest Preserve Foundation provides leisureships so that cost isn't a barrier to kids to attending summer day camps from the Forest Preserve District of Kane County.

Help endangered Blanding's turtles in the Kane County forest preserves. This program funds research, education, seasonal staff, technology, field supplies, and habitat improvements. Adopt a turtle, today!
